Back in 2008, they were selling for $200k with fresh paint jobs that almost cost as much and there was WAY more dockage, repair services, and much cheaper parts available back then.

I sold boats that had $700k bank payoffs for as low as $75k. Banks received TARP funds, and bankers were like “We just received one billion dollars with no strings attached, what do I care about that loan? Screw it-sell it”. caveat being that didn’t work on loans from yacht lenders, that had been immediately resold.
